https://github.com/apache/spark/pull/13013 has updated the doc for
insertInto and saveAsTable. The main difference between them is that
`insertInto` use position-based column resolution (like SQL's insert into
statement), while `saveAsTable` uses column-name-based column resolution (like
applying a project on top of the data).
